Two COVID Programs To Remain Until June

The federal government’s two major COVID-19 support programs will remain in place.

Prime Minister Justin Trudeau says the government will extend the Canada Emergency Wage Subsidy and the Canada Emergency Rent Subsidy until June.

“In other words, we’re making sure the wage and rent subsidies continue through the spring and that the amount of support remains consistent,” explained the prime minister

Trudeau adds this is not the time to pull back on support for workers or business owners “It’s a time to see people through what is hopefully, the final stretch of this crisis.”
